Create a Class in UML Mode Raptor

Object-oriented Flowchart

Overview

In this tutorial, we will create a class using the Raptor flowchart tool. In order to create a class, we need to enable object-oriented UML mode in Raptor the tool.

UML Mode

Launch the Raptor flowchart tool.

Click Mode >> Object-oriented.

 

 

Switching to Object-Oriented mode will enable a new tab in the flowchart tool UI.

 

 

New Class

A Class is used to create objects. Class is a template that describes the state and behavior of the objects. An Object is an instance of the class.

 

 

To create a new class, right click on choose  Right click >> New >>  Class in the UML tab.

 

 

We can specify the class name in the Name textbox, choose access and modifier settings for the class.
